Paris and Rome are in the same time zone. Both cities share the same local time, so scheduling between them needs no conversion.
The best overlap between Paris and Rome working hours (09:00–17:00) is 09:00–17:00 Rome time — that's 09:00–17:00 in Paris — about 8 hours of shared time.
